Preventive Techniques Vets Use to Protect Pet Teeth

Professional Dental Cleanings

Routine professional dental cleanings are one of the most effective ways to protect pets’ teeth. During these cleanings, our veterinarian removes plaque and tartar that accumulate on teeth and along the gumline. We also check for early signs of dental disease such as gingivitis, fractures, or oral infections. Cleaning under anesthesia allows for a thorough examination and ensures pets remain calm and safe throughout the procedure.

Dental Examinations

Regular dental examinations help detect problems early. Our veterinarians assess tooth alignment, gum health, and signs of oral discomfort. Early detection allows for timely intervention, preventing more serious conditions that could affect overall health. Exam results also guide the development of personalized dental care plans for each pet.

At-Home Care

Our vet encourages clients to maintain consistent at-home dental routines. Brushing a pet’s teeth with veterinarian-recommended toothpaste, offering dental chews, and providing specialized diets can reduce plaque buildup. These techniques complement professional care and keep teeth and gums healthy between visits.

Preventive Nutritional Strategies

Nutrition plays a key role in dental hygiene. We may recommend diets formulated to support strong teeth and reduce tartar formation. Proper hydration, balanced vitamins, and minerals also contribute to maintaining oral health. Some pets benefit from foods designed with specific textures that naturally clean teeth as they chew, which adds an extra layer of protection.

Fluoride and Dental Products

Certain veterinary-approved dental rinses and gels can strengthen enamel and reduce bacterial growth. Applying these products enhances other preventive measures. Many of these products also contain ingredients that freshen breath and keep your pet’s teeth in good condition.
